Output d107f71bf09baba0e270dd85d28a768094cff627a5291017fff7dd7934103352:50

value
17260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f80e15387c0d8d7a97d0c5a4f0ce59abecd8e10 OP_EQUALVERIFY OP_CHECKSIG
address
1JTaTPiDEqPL7H3GJ3EhBzG9Jb8cUhSHmu
transaction
d107f71bf09baba0e270dd85d28a768094cff627a5291017fff7dd7934103352
spent
true